Senior Project Manager : Portland, Oregon 112129
Portland | www.tiptopjob.com |
PacifiCorp is seeking customer:centric candidates to grow and sustain our commitment to a culture of customer service excellence, environmental sustainability and diversity, equity and inclusion.
General Purpose
Manages the development and implementation of projects by providing strategic direction to a team responsible for project development including design, analysis, feasibility studies, budget and schedule. Establishes project goals, negotiates timelines/schedules, and develops project plans.
Responsibilities
• Promote a customer first culture and commit to delivering outstanding results for customers.
• Manage one or more highly complex projects, research, track, and report on initiatives.
• Ensure that deliverables are completed in accordance to the PacifiCorp Project Governance and Standards.
• Develop and implement projects by providing strategic direction to a team.
• Appoint Work Stream leaders (when necessary) to manage significant subsets of projects.
• Analyze and evaluate datasets or documents to define critical tasks.
• Recommend project plans, timelines, and budgets to management, and monitor progress against plan.
• Evaluate and establish project goals, develop project plans, and negotiate timelines and schedules.
• Communicate project objectives, parameters, status, and outcomes. Manage client expectations.
• Develop effective communication plans and implementation plans to ensure that deliverables from significant programs and initiatives are sustainable within the organization.
• Develop financial documents for all aspects of budget reporting.
• Oversee the budget development and coordinate budget activities with various groups.
• Participate with Procurement in Vendor/Client negotiations as a driver and facilitator.
• Manage any vendor staff performing work on projects.
• Collaborate with Customer Solutions personnel and other staff to provide input and technical services in the development and execution of the project.
Requirements
• Bachelor's Degree in Business or Engineering; or the equivalent combination of education.
• Five years related professional experience.
• Previous experience leading complex project teams or in a leadership role.
• Analytical and evaluation skills to define critical tasks, establish sequence of events, identify individuals/teams, timelines and outcomes and to produce project plans.
• Project management skills to develop and monitor work agreements and budgets, determine specifications, schedules, timelines, and define deliverables.
• Advanced communication and interpersonal skills to interface with team members and customers to promote positive customer outcomes.
• Interpersonal and communication skills to facilitate team efforts, provide guidance and direction to team members.
• Financial modeling to quantify costs and benefits of projects and to track and maintain project budgets.
• Knowledge of project management techniques, the company's business, applicable policies, procedures, and practices, and federal, state, and local laws.
• Expertise in the use of technical applications, software, and tools.
Preferences
• Knowledge of distributed energy resources, energy efficiency, and behind:the:meter technologies.
• PMP or CEM Certification.
• Working knowledge of SAP or similar systems in cost tracking and forecasting.
• Utility Industry experience.
